Seems things have changed with Notary Assurance.
Posted by  Yoli/CA of CA on 1/19/17 12:29pm Msg #568501
Worked with them quite a bit in 2012; a few times in 2013; and only once in 2015. They always paid well and on time.

Never had to pay to get on their database. In fact, I believe I remember reading here a few years ago that if they call you, no fee. However, if you asked to be on the database, then there was a fee. Further, I was never asked to complete a signup package with them.

Just my opinion, if I were in your shoes, I'd proceed with the PayPal claim. I am not an employee. I am an independent contractor. I will provide my EIN -- not my SS#. However, it's your business and only you can decide what you're willing to put up with.
